New 3TB SATA disk added to X 1600 G2 NAS

We tried to install 3TB HDD for NAS Server (HP X1660 G2), found new HDD defective.

 After installing HDD it shows 0 MB size in HP Array Configuration Utility.

If try to Erase it, server gets restart & gets hang on startup.

After  removing new HDD Server working properly

"HP Smart Array Controller Firmware Version 5.06 is the minimum firmware version required to support 3TB or larger HP SAS/SATA hard drives attached to an HP Smart Array P212, P410/P410i, P411, or P812 Controller."
